Closing Prices for Crude Oil, Gold and Other Commodities (Aug. 9)

Benchmark U.S. crude oil for September delivery fell 26 cents to $90.50 a barrel Tuesday. Brent crude for October delivery fell 34 cents to $96.31 a barrel. Ukraine Halted Oil Flows to Europe Over Payment Issue, Russia’s Transneft Says

MOSCOW—Ukraine has suspended Russian oil pipeline flows to parts of central Europe since early this month because Western sanctions prevented it from accepting transit fees from Moscow, Russian pipeline monopoly Transneft said on Tuesday. Oil Slips Amid Chance of Iran Nuclear Deal Supply Boost

LONDON—Oil dropped over $1 a barrel on Tuesday, approaching a multi-month low hit last week, pressured by the latest progress in talks to revive the 2015 Iran nuclear accord, which would eventually allow Tehran to boost exports in a tight market. Stocks Stumble as Caution Reigns Ahead of US Inflation Data

LONDON—Shares slipped and the dollar hung off recent highs on Tuesday as investors eyed U.S. inflation data due a day later that will likely yield clues to any further aggressive Federal Reserve rate hikes. Two More Grain Ships Leave Ukraine, Bringing Total to 12 Under New Deal

ISTANBUL—Two more grain-carrying ships left Ukraine’s Chornomorsk port on Tuesday, Turkey’s defense ministry said, as part of a deal to unblock Ukrainian sea exports, bringing the total to leave the country under a safe passage deal to 12. Closing Prices for Crude Oil, Gold and Other Commodities (Aug. 8)

Benchmark U.S. crude oil for September delivery rose $1.75 to $90.76 a barrel Monday. Brent crude for October delivery rose $1.73 to $96.65 a barrel. 3rd Oil Storage Tank Collapses in Cuba Terminal Following Fire, Spill: Governor

HAVANA—A third crude tank caught fire and collapsed at Cuba’s main oil terminal Matanzas, a local governor said on Monday, as an oil spill spread flames from a second tank that caught fire two days earlier in the island’s biggest oil industry accident in decades. Turkey Offers ‘A Warehouse and Bridge’ for Metals Trade to Russia

ISTANBUL—Western sanctions have given the Turkish metals sector a chance to serve as “warehouse and bridge,” the head of an industry group said, citing increased interest from Russian companies and also from EU companies seeking to sell to Russia via Turkey. Oil Stays Near Multi-Month Lows on Demand Worries

LONDON—Oil prices inched up from multi-month lows on Monday as lingering worries about demand weakening on the back of a darkened economic outlook outweighed some positive economic data from China and the United States.
